Subject: Quickstore 4.2 — bloom filter now fronts the KV layer

Plugin authors: starting with this release, Quickstore places a bloom filter ahead of the key-value store. Negative lookups return faster; false positives fall through safely. No API changes are required on your side. Verify your plugin against the staging build referenced below.

session token of fahif-tadup = htk3_9c7

## Ticket: Locked Vault Blocking Invoicer Release — Paperquill PDF Renderer

For the security reviewer: the signing vault for the Paperquill invoice renderer locked itself after three failed unseal attempts during last night's deploy. No evidence of tampering; audit trail shows the attempts came from the CI runner with a stale credential. We have rotated the runner credential and verified the vault image checksum. To complete the manual unseal, the operator should enter the recovery passphrase noted directly below.

unlock words, fajep-fawig: fraiel-silok-kaseth-oliir

Subject: Feedwright validator cut-over complete

Hi Mara,

The cut-over of the Feedwright podcast feed validator finished cleanly at 06:40. All traffic now routes to the new parser cluster; the legacy nodes are drained and will be decommissioned Friday. Error rates held under 0.2% throughout, and the enclosure-size checks are now enforced rather than advisory. Rollback remains possible for 72 hours. The production settings the new cluster is running with are listed below.

deployment values, fahap-hahaf:
[casdor]
port = 9200
region = south-2
host = casdor.qirvanworks.corp
timeout_ms = 3000
retries = 4